Choosing Godly TV Content for My Child: A Christian Mother’s Perspective
As my son has grown, I’ve noticed an increasing interest in watching television. Like many young children, he is naturally drawn to music, movement, colors, and sound. However, this growing curiosity has made me even more intentional and prayerful about what he is exposed to.
As a Christian mother, I believe that what our children watch matters. Media has the power to shape beliefs, behaviors, and values—especially during the early, formative years. Scripture instructs us to “train up a child in the way he should go” (Proverbs 22:6), and I take that responsibility seriously, even when it comes to screen time.
My desire is to ensure that my son is exposed to godly content—content that teaches him about holiness, gently introduces the reality of sin in an age-appropriate way, and encourages him to adopt Christ-like character traits such as love, obedience, kindness, humility, and reverence for God.
The Challenge With Mainstream Children’s Content
One of the biggest challenges I’ve encountered is the lack of wholesome, faith-based children’s programming online. Much of today’s mainstream content is filled with violence, disobedience being celebrated, confusing messages, and themes that do not align with our Christian beliefs or the values we want to instill in our home.
This realization led me on a purposeful search for Christian alternatives—shows that are not only entertaining but also spiritually edifying.
Christian Streaming Platforms for Kids
Through this journey, I discovered several Christian streaming platforms that provide safe, Biblically grounded content for children:
- Minno – A Christian streaming service created specifically for kids
- Yippee TV – Offers Christ-centered children’s shows with strong Biblical values
- PureFlix – Provides Christian movies, series, and family-friendly children’s programming
These platforms make it easier for parents to feel confident about what their children are watching. Additionally, some trusted Christian shows can also be found on YouTube (with supervision), including:
- VeggieTales
- Owlegories
- Superbook
- Cubekins
- Friends and Heroes
Advise to Christian Parents
Television itself is not the enemy—but unfiltered exposure can be harmful, especially for young, impressionable hearts. As parents, we are called to be gatekeepers, discerning what we allow into our homes and into our children’s lives.
My prayer is that we raise children who not only recognize God but love Him, fear Him, and desire to walk in His ways—even from a young age.
With prayer, discernment, and intentional choices, it is possible to use media in a way that supports, rather than undermines, our faith and values.
